Ticket: Config drift in ValiGate plugin loader

For review: the ValiGate data-validator plugin system is loading a different plugin allowlist in staging than what's committed in the repo. Someone hand-edited the staging config to unblock the Thornbury import job, and the change was never backported, so strict-mode validators are silently skipped there. This PR restores the committed state and adds a drift check to CI. Please diff the running values against the intended configuration, which follows.

settings of fafog-haduf:
ZORIX_PIN=4648
ZORIX_METRICS_HOST=metrics.zorix.paliqsys.corp
ZORIX_LOG_LEVEL=info
ZORIX_TENANT=druix

## Formula Sandbox — Quandle Sheets

User-supplied formulas in Quandle execute inside an isolated evaluator with no filesystem, network, or clock access. Each evaluation gets a hard CPU and memory cap, and recursion depth is bounded. Violations kill the worker and log the formula hash. If the sandbox pool exhausts, requests queue rather than fall through. The current sandbox limits are set as follows.

deployment values, yafop-tahof:
HOLIX_HOST=holix.zemvarsys.internal
HOLIX_PORT=3306

Subject: Pool car keys — new cabinet

Hi night shift,

Quick heads-up: the pool car keys have moved from the drawer behind the front desk to the new wall cabinet by the Garrow Street exit. Please log each key you take on the clipboard next to it. To open the cabinet, punch in the code below.

badge for fafop-fajof: bdg-Z-47

Following repeated delivery slippage from Halvane Components, procurement has shortlisted three alternative suppliers for the Ostrell valve assembly: Brenmark Industrial, Quillon Fabrication, and Tarset Works. Site audits are complete for two of the three; Tarset's audit is scheduled within a fortnight. Qualification samples are expected to add eight weeks to the timeline, so no switch is feasible before Q3. Costs are broadly comparable, with Brenmark slightly ahead on lead times. The strategic rationale is summarised in the note below.

confidential, kagup-bafog: Fraaxax Group is in early talks to buy Soroxox Group for about $343.8 million. The Olidor launch date is June 14, and nothing goes to the press before then. Legal wants the Aldmirek Logistics term sheet signed before July 23.